As info, ATF had this in a bulletin:

“We cannot make changes to a submitted NFA eForm. If you make an error in the name or serial number, you will need to contact the NFA Branch at (304) 616-4500 and request the withdrawal of the form. You will then need to submit a new application. Please ensure that the information is correct upon submission.”

So, you can call...but I've read quite a few members here post they cancelled using Ask the Experts. I believe some also emailed, but not sure if they emailed Gary directly or used the [email protected] address.
